El amplificador definitivo: 50 años persiguiendo la perfección sonora.

In this second chapter, we delve into one of the most radical developments in high-end audio: a system designed without compromise, where every decision is driven by a single objective—maximum sonic fidelity. Throughout the video, we analyze a completely hand-built tube preamplifier and hybrid power amplifier, the result of decades of research, testing, and an obsessive attention to detail. We discuss key concepts such as the absence of feedback, the real impact of tubes versus transistors, the design of extreme power supplies, and how all of this influences signal purity. We also explore unconventional decisions in the industry: the partial use of triodes to avoid internal contamination, unique hybrid topologies, and technical solutions aimed at preserving the integrity of the musical message above all else. This isn't a video about products. It's a conversation about engineering, the philosophy of sound, and the true limits of home audio.
